Workshop on socio-economic analysis in applications for authorisation and restrictions under REACH

The European Chemicals Agency (ECHA) and the European Commission (Directorate-General for Internal Market, Industry, Entrepreneurship and SMEs, and Directorate-General for Environment) is organising a workshop on socio-economic analysis in applications for authorisation and restrictions under REACH on 29 June 2016.

This event aims to clarify the role of socio-economic analysis (SEA) under REACH. Key topics to discuss are:

  • what SEA does and what it does not do
  • why SEA is needed
  • what is possible and meaningful to carry out as part of SEA
  • how the opinions of SEAC are derived in practice
  • how SEA is used in decision-making
  • how best to communicate SEA-related issues and conclusions to stakeholders.

The workshop material will be made public on ECHA's and the Commission's websites.
